A celebration of the people, recipes and plants Penny Woodward and Pam Vardy, Large-format, full-colour PB, 176 pp.

Revel in the richness and diversity of these inner-city community gardens, and let the people who use them be your guides to:

* the many fascinating and unusual edible plants they grow and use

* their stories, touching on the events that brought these extraordinary people from more than 20 different countries to Australia

* what their gardens mean to them, what they grew in their homelands and what they grow in Australia

* their simple, home-style recipes using the vegetables and herbs gathered from these gardens

* tips for successful gardening, like pine needles for strawberries and chicken manure to warm the soil in winter.

Edible Water Gardens is the first complete guide to growing and using edible wetland plants worldwide.
Practical and easy-to-use, this book will appeal to a wide spectrum of readers, from water gardeners and commercial growers, botanists and plant historians, to students of aquaculture and horticulture in senior college and graduate courses – as well as anyone wanting to create an edible water garden in the backyard.
All plants are arranged in natural ecological groups for easy selection, from deeper waters to the water’s edge.
Edible Water Gardens covers everything you need to know to grow edible plants in and beside the water, including:
* Every freshwater aquatic and water’s edge plant known to be grown or harvested for food
* Spectacular ornamentals
* Ecological requirements, including soils, light, water conditions, zones, natural cycles, oxygen and carbon dioxide
* Underwater ‘landscaping’
* Growing systems, propagation and fertilisers
* Other useful and saleable species, from micro-algae and mangroves, pond and aquarium plants, to unusual cut flowers

    This book is a practical guide to using some of the more common, and some of the slightly less common leaves one comes across at the market. Each leaf is described in detail, to help readers learn to identify them. The medicinal properties of the leaves are also included together with accompanying recipes so that readers can learn how to prepare delicious and nourishing dishes with the various leaves. Some of the leaves featured in the book include Agathi, Basil, Noni, Rice Paddy Herb, Seeru Keerai, Shiso, Ulam Raja to name some.

    Filled with beautiful food shots, Cooking with Asian Leaves is a one of its kind, innovative cookbook and a perfect companion for anyone who is intrigued by the sight, smells and tastes of the leaves used in Asian cooking.
